## Overview

LivePerson's AI-powered conversational platform and Salesforce's CRM are two of the most-used systems in any customer-facing organization. When they run in silos, agents lose context, leads go unqualified, and customer data ends up scattered. Integrating LivePerson with Salesforce on tray.ai lets you automatically sync chat transcripts, leads, cases, and contact records, closing the loop between every customer conversation and your CRM.

Sales and support teams treat Salesforce as their source of truth, but live chat and AI-driven conversations in LivePerson generate a lot of data that rarely makes it back into the CRM on its own. Integrating LivePerson with Salesforce through tray.ai cuts out manual data entry, makes sure every conversation triggers the right follow-up in Salesforce, and gives agents a full view of a customer's CRM history before they type their first response. That connection speeds up lead qualification, cuts case resolution times, and means conversation outcomes — a sale, a support ticket, a churn signal — show up in Salesforce records, dashboards, and workflows right away.

## Use cases

### Automatically Create Salesforce Leads from LivePerson Chat Sessions

When a prospect engages via LivePerson and meets qualifying criteria — visiting a pricing page or spending a set amount of time in conversation — a new lead record is created in Salesforce immediately. Contact details, intent signals, and chat summaries are mapped directly to the lead record, so no high-intent conversation disappears between your chat platform and your sales pipeline.

- Eliminate manual lead creation and reduce data entry errors
- Capture intent signals and conversation context directly on Salesforce lead records
- Accelerate lead response times by triggering Salesforce lead assignment rules immediately

### Sync LivePerson Conversation Transcripts to Salesforce Cases

Every time a customer support conversation closes in LivePerson, the full chat transcript is automatically attached to the matching Salesforce Case, Contact, or Account record. Agents and managers can review the entire conversation history without leaving Salesforce, building a complete, auditable log of customer interactions that holds up for QA, compliance, and ongoing service improvement.

- Give support agents full conversation context without switching between platforms
- Build a complete, searchable interaction history on every Salesforce record
- Support compliance and QA audits with automatically archived transcripts

### Update Salesforce Contact Records with LivePerson Engagement Data

As customers engage through LivePerson's messaging channels, their contact data — updated email addresses, phone numbers, stated preferences — can be automatically written back to their Salesforce Contact record. This two-way sync keeps your CRM current with information gathered during real conversations, so teams always work from accurate customer profiles without manual reconciliation.

- Maintain accurate, enriched contact records in Salesforce automatically
- Eliminate duplicate data entry across LivePerson and Salesforce
- Improve personalization by reflecting real-time conversation data in the CRM

### Trigger Salesforce Opportunities from LivePerson Sales Conversations

When a LivePerson AI bot or live agent spots a sales opportunity — an upsell signal or a new product inquiry — an Opportunity record can be automatically created or updated in Salesforce. Product interest, conversation sentiment, and estimated value can be pre-populated from the conversation data, giving sales managers instant pipeline visibility from every assisted conversation.

- Capture upsell and cross-sell opportunities identified during live chat
- Pre-populate Opportunity fields with conversation-derived data to speed up rep workflows
- Ensure every qualified sales conversation shows up in Salesforce pipeline reporting

### Route LivePerson Chats Based on Salesforce CRM Data

By pulling Salesforce data — account tier, open cases, assigned account owner — into LivePerson at the start of a conversation, you can route customers to the right agent or bot without guesswork. A high-value enterprise customer goes straight to a dedicated account team; a customer with an open support case goes to a service specialist. CRM-driven routing is better for customers and more efficient for agents.

- Deliver VIP treatment to high-value accounts by routing them to dedicated agents
- Reduce handling time by connecting customers to the most contextually relevant agent
- Use existing Salesforce segmentation to power smarter LivePerson routing rules

### Create and Update Salesforce Cases from LivePerson Bot Escalations

When a LivePerson AI bot can't resolve a customer issue and escalates to a human agent, a Salesforce Case is automatically created with the full bot conversation history already attached. The case is assigned based on issue type, severity, or customer tier as stored in Salesforce, so customers don't have to repeat themselves after escalation — which is one of the fastest ways to lose their trust.

- Eliminate context loss during bot-to-human escalation handoffs
- Automatically assign cases based on Salesforce business rules and queues
- Reduce average handle time by providing agents with full pre-escalation conversation history

### Sync LivePerson CSAT Scores to Salesforce for Reporting and Alerting

Post-conversation satisfaction scores collected in LivePerson are automatically written to the associated Salesforce Case, Contact, or Account record, so customer health reporting lives in one place. Low CSAT scores can trigger Salesforce alerts or tasks, prompting account managers to reach out before a dissatisfied customer quietly churns. It's a direct line between your voice-of-the-customer data and your CRM-driven retention workflows.

- Centralize customer satisfaction data within Salesforce for unified reporting
- Trigger proactive retention workflows based on low CSAT score thresholds
- Correlate conversation satisfaction with account health, ARR, and churn risk in Salesforce

## Challenges Tray.ai solves

### Matching LivePerson Conversations to the Correct Salesforce Records

LivePerson conversations are often started by anonymous users, or by customers using a different email than what's in Salesforce. Without solid matching logic in place before anything gets written to the CRM, duplicates and mismatched records pile up fast.

**How Tray.ai helps:** Tray.ai's workflow logic lets you build multi-step matching strategies — looking up customers by email, phone number, or custom identifiers in sequence — and apply fuzzy matching or deduplication logic before any Salesforce record is created or updated, so data quality stays high across every sync.

### Handling High-Volume Real-Time Conversation Events

Enterprise LivePerson deployments can generate thousands of conversation events per hour. Processing each one in real time risks hitting Salesforce API rate limits or creating noticeable lag in CRM updates during peak traffic.

**How Tray.ai helps:** Tray.ai's event-driven architecture handles high-throughput webhook streams from LivePerson without breaking a sweat, with built-in Salesforce API rate limit management, retry logic, and queue-based processing so no events are dropped and CRM updates stay timely even under heavy load.

### Mapping Diverse LivePerson Conversation Attributes to Salesforce Fields

LivePerson conversations carry a lot of metadata — intent classifications, sentiment scores, engagement attributes, bot interaction history — and all of it needs to land in the right Salesforce standard and custom fields without data loss or schema mismatches.

**How Tray.ai helps:** Tray.ai's visual data mapper and JSONPath-based transformation tools make it straightforward to extract, reshape, and map any LivePerson conversation attribute to the right Salesforce field, with the flexibility to handle nested JSON structures and dynamic attribute sets without custom code.

### Maintaining Sync Consistency Across Bot and Human Conversation Phases

A single customer interaction in LivePerson can span multiple phases — starting with a bot, escalating to an agent, transferring between queues. That produces fragmented conversation events that need to be stitched together before anything coherent gets written to Salesforce.

**How Tray.ai helps:** Tray.ai supports stateful workflow designs that accumulate conversation events using a persistent conversation ID as the key, aggregating bot and human interaction data across the full session before creating a single, coherent Salesforce record that reflects the entire customer interaction.

### Keeping Sensitive Customer Data Compliant Across Both Platforms

Chat transcripts passed from LivePerson to Salesforce often contain PII or sensitive customer details covered by GDPR, CCPA, or industry-specific regulations. Without careful data handling, that's a real compliance risk.

**How Tray.ai helps:** Tray.ai supports enterprise-grade security controls including data masking, field-level encryption, and configurable data retention policies within workflow pipelines, so teams can strip, anonymize, or selectively redact sensitive PII before it reaches Salesforce and stay on the right side of regulatory requirements.
